Office design in 2011 is as varied as the design of buildings into which the offices are fitted. Priorities and motivations vary between developers, tenants, and architects.Large companies have recently been moving into squat ‘sidescrapers’ in newly opened up areas of cities. This shift towards campus-style accommodation is driven as much by lower land prices as the will to increase communication by putting more people on each floor, according to Nick Fowell of Graham Nicholas design. Recent instances include NAB and ANZ in Melbourne’s Docklands, and SA Water in Adelaide. All are characterised by central atriums, which bounce light down into the large floor plates, and increase ‘vertical connectivity’ between staff.
